Peace Activists Get the Boot in SF
Friday, 23 March 2007
SAN FRANCISCO, Calif. (KCBS/AP) — Just hours before the House is expected to vote on an Iraq funding bill, police rousted demonstrators camped outside Speaker Nancy Pelosi’s Pacific Heights residence.
Gone are the tents, tables, banners, candles and flowers. All that remained early this morning of the so-called “Camp Pelosi” was a handful of people sleeping in vehicles.
“We’re going to set up camp again tomorrow, as soon as we check with the lawyers,” said a protester who identified himself with the group Veterans for Peace. “We’re pretty sure we’re right that they can’t just come, and they claim they had a neighbor complain.”
Most of the group has been present for a dozen or so days, opposing any additional funding for the war…

Protesters continue vigil outside Pelosi’s S.F. home Marisa Lagos, Chronicle Staff Writer
Friday, March 23, 2007
(03-23) 12:57 PDT SAN FRANCISCO — A small group of protesters continued a vigil at Rep. Nancy Pelosi’s Pacific Heights home today, where members of an anti-war group have been posted for 12 days.
The protesters were demanding that Pelosi de-fund the Iraq war, and said they were disappointed with today’s vote in the House of Representatives, where members approved a $124 million spending bill that sets an Aug. 31, 2008, date for withdrawing all U.S. forces from Iraq.
Toby Blome, the lead organizer of "Camp Pelosi," said the group would hold a candlelight vigil tonight at sunset.
Blome said after today’s vote, the protesters, who are members of Code Pink: Women for Peace, will continue some sort of vigil at the House Speaker’s home.
"We’re not going away," she said.
"We want to remind her that Americans are watching her closely."The group will hold another gathering Saturday at Alta Plaza Park nearby, she said, beginning at 5:30 p.m.
